TI: Gravity and Magnetic Surveys of the Weaubleau Quadrangle, South Central Missouri: Implications for an Impact Origin of the Weaubleau – Osceola Structure

AB: In August, 2001 (gravity, magnetic) and May, 2005 (magnetic) high density, GPS-registered gravity and magnetic surveys were conducted throughout the Weaubleau (pronounced WAH-blow), MO quadrangle (located approximately 90 km north of Springfield). The 2001 survey occupied 110 sites, while the 2005 survey occupied 73 sites, with some re-occupation of the 2001 survey sites. This quadrangle was chosen for study in part because it forms the southeast quarter of a proposed impact crater. Evans et al. (2003, 2004) have proposed a 19 km structure, named the Weaubleau-Osceola structure, based on surface geology and topography. We present the results of the geophysical surveys here. In addition, perform a comparison of our reduced anomaly results with synthetic anomalies from impact structure forward models. Preliminary analysis shows little geophysical support for an impact origin for the structure.
